Navigation Pane
The Navigation Pane, located on the left-hand side of the Access Analyzer Console, lists all the major functions of Access Analyzer in a collapsible list format. Clicking on any node with an arrow will open a collapsible list that shows more navigation, configuration, and use options.
The items in the Navigation Pane are:
- Settings – Opens the Global Settings section for configurations which affect the running of Access Analyzer jobs. See the Global Settings topic for additional information.
- Host Management – Opens the Host Management section for inventorying and managing hosts to be targeted by Access Analyzer jobs. See the Host Management topic for additional information.
- Host Discovery - Opens the Host Discovery section for discovering hosts to be targeted by the Access Analyzer jobs. See the Host Discovery topic for additional information.
- Running Instances – Displays progress for all running jobs. This includes jobs that are run by a scheduled task, interactively within the open Access Analyzer instance, or interactively in any other running instance of Access Analyzer See the Running Instances Node topic for additional information.
- Schedules – Opens the Scheduled Actions view which displays information on all scheduled tasks. See the Schedules topic for additional information.
- Jobs – Lists all solutions, job groups, and jobs within a folder structure. See the Jobs Tree topic for additional information.
The title above the Navigation Pane will change depending on what is selected. There are also several right-click or context menus available throughout the console. See the Navigation Pane Right-click Menus topic for additional information.

Host Management Right-click Menus
The following right-click menus are available within the Host Management node.
See the Host Management topic for additional information on these actions.
Discovery Node
The Discovery node right click-menu can be accessed in the Host Management node in the Navigation Pane.
The Discovery node right-click menu options are:
- Create Query – Opens the Host Discovery Wizard
- Suspend/Resume Query Queue – Pauses or resumes the host discovery queue
All Hosts Node
The All Hosts node right-click menu can be accessed in the Host Management node in the Navigation Pane.
The All Hosts right-click menu options are:
- Add Hosts – Opens the Add Hosts window
- Refresh Lists – Refreshes host list
- Refresh Hosts – Executes the host inventory query
- Save Selected to Lists – Opens the Add Hosts window with the selected hosts already added to a new list
- Schedule – Opens the Schedule (Activities Pane Option) window to schedule a host inventory query
- Export Data – Export the current data grid to an HTML file, an XML file, or a CSV file
- Suspend/Resume Host Inventory – Pauses or resumes a host inventory query
All Hosts > [Host List] Node
The All Hosts > [Host List] right-click menu can be accessed in the Host Management node in the Navigation Pane.
The All Hosts > [Host List] node right-click menu options are:
- Edit List – Opens the Add Hosts window for the selected list
- Rename List – Opens the Host list name window
- Delete List – Delete the selected host list
- Refresh List – Refreshes host list
- Refresh Hosts – Executes the host inventory query
- Save Selected to List – Opens the Add Hosts window with the selected hosts already added to a new list
- Schedule – Opens the Schedule (Activities Pane Option) window to schedule a host inventory query
- Export Data – Export the current data grid to an HTML file, an XML file, or a CSV file
- Suspend Host Inventory – Pauses or resumes a host inventory query

Jobs Tree Primary Nodes
The Job tree primary nodes have the following right-click menu items:
NOTE: These menu items apply to a Jobs Tree, Job Group, and a Job. Depending on the chosen selection, some menu items are grayed out.

Menu items include:
-
Run Group/Jobs – Executes the selected job group or job
-
Publish – Publishes the reports from the selected job group or job without regenerating the report. See the Reporting topic for additional information.
-
Lock Group/Job – Locks job group or job, indicating configuration has been approved and the job group or job is ready to be scheduled/run. This option only applies to Role Based Access. See the Role Based Access topic for additional information.
-
Unlock Group/Job – Unlocks job group or job, indicating the configuration has not been approved or needs to be modified. Unlocking a job will prevent Job Initiators from scheduling or running the job. This option only applies to Role Based Access. See the Role Based Access for additional information.
-
Enable/Disable Job(s) – Disables the selected job or job group and skips them during scan execution. When a job group is disabled, all existing jobs within the job group are disabled. See the Disable or Enable a Job topic for more information.
-
Schedules – Opens the Schedule Jobs to schedule job group or job execution
-
Refresh Tree – Refreshes the Jobs tree
-
Changes – Opens the Changes Window to track changes to job configuration in a change log
-
Cut – Cuts the selected job group or job (Ctrl+X)
-
Copy – Copies the selected job group or job (Ctrl+C)
-
Paste – Pastes a copied/cut job group or job to the selected location (Ctrl+V)
CAUTION: Delete Group/Job will also delete all tables that match the job’s naming convention from the database.
-
Delete Group/Job – Deletes the selected job group or job. See the Report Cleanup when Deleting a Job or Job Group topic for additional information.
CAUTION: Rename Group/Job will rename all tables that match the job’s naming convention within the database.
-
Rename Group/Job – Opens a textbox over the selected job group or job to rename
-
Export – Zips the selected job group or job. Options allow for including the job, the reports, and/or the job log and SA_Debug log.
- Save the ZIP file to a desired location, and optionally attach it to an email to Netwrix Support.
- Email option requires Notification settings to be configured.
-
Create Job (Ctrl+Alt+A) – Creates a new job at the same location as the selected job group or job. See the Create a New Job topic for additional information.
-
Add Instant Job – Opens the Instant Job Wizard.
-
Create Group – Creates a new job group within the selected location
-
Explore Folder – Opens the Windows Explorer folder for the select object
-
Properties – Opens the Job Properties window
